The 2007 Create Awards - one of the top creative competitions for professionals and students in advertising, film and video, motion graphics, graphic communication, photography, printing, interactive media, and copywriting - announces its official call for entries.

Following a successful first year, The 2007 Create Awards (www.thecreateawards.com) has tripled the Best of Show Award to a once-in-a-lifetime prize for the creative professional: a $30,000 Dream Studio Prize Package with products from industry-leading companies including: Adobe, Hewlett-Packard, Kodak, NEC Display Solutions, Alienware Computers, Wacom Technologies, Digital Tutors, Softimage (a Division of Avid), Iomega, Wiredrive, Microtek, Inovartis, LensBabies, E-Frontier, Spam Cube, AutoFX, Corel, Pantone, Tivity Software, and Extensis.

Also new for 2007: prize packages for all eight Best of Industry Winners (Advertising/Art Direction, Film + Video, Motion Graphics, Graphic Communication, Photography, Interactive, Copywriting/Words, and Self Promotion) and one Best of Student Prize Package worth more than $2,000. The winner of the Paper/Printing/Packaging Industry, sponsored by NewPage, receives their logo on a NASCAR car along with race day tickets to experience the prize.

Gen Art and Planet Green Game, a partnership between Starbucks and Global Green USA, offer seven filmmakers an opportunity to share their thoughts, concerns, hopes and visions about the growing climate crisis by showcasing their "Green" themed short films through the Gen Art Online Film Festival. The festival will take place online and "in world" at PlanetGreenGame.com. Through online voting, one of the seven filmmakers will win $2,500 plus and a premiere screening at the 12th annual Gen Art Film Festival, presented by Acura, in New York City.

A panel of judges from Gen Art, one of the leading arts and entertainment organizations dedicated to showcasing the best emerging talent in film, fashion, visual arts and music, will choose the seven "Green" themed short films based on originality, quality of filmmaking and poignancy of "Green" theme. From March 29 to April 13, 2007, the seven shorts will be available for viewing and voting on www.genartfestival.com/online and through an interactive avatar based environment on planetgreengame.com.

A premiere at the 12th Annual Gen Art Film Festival will be an opportunity for the winning filmmakers to enhance their career by exposing their work to a powerful audience, gaining crucial media exposure and strengthening industry relations. Unique to the GAFF only two films are shown each evening of the festival, one short and one feature but on one of the festival nights it will be complimented by the Gen Art Online Film Festival Winner.

InsideCG.com is hosting a wallpaper contest where contestants create a high-resolution (1600 pixels wide x 1200 pixels tall) desktop wallpaper featuring the InsideCG logo. Other than the InsideCG.com name and the InsideCG logo, the work must be entirely your original creation, and created for this contest. Digital Art, 2D, 3D are all acceptable. InsideCg will pick its three favorite pieces of wallpaper to win.

Submit your entries by email to wallpaper@insidecg.com. Entries should be submitted in .JPG format with a maximum size of 500kb. Include in the email your full name and e-mail address. Prizes include LightWave v9, Realviz Vtour, Realviz Stitcher Pro and messiah:studio Professional 2.4. For more information, visit www.InsideCG.com.

Recognized as a cutting-edge competition, Script P.I.M.P. allows for online submissions and guarantees that each script will receive at least two reads from a judging panel of agents, development directors and managers. All finalists become part of the extensive Script P.I.M.P. online community and get a free, five-year membership to its Writers Database (a massive collection of contact information, production company listings, and general industry facts). A Writers Workshop is also available to help develop scripts even further. Prizes for the four grand prize winners include: * $2,500 cash ($10,000 total) * Guaranteed circulation to over 20 Companies * Five-year memberships to Script Pimp's Writers Database * Featured 'Script Pimp Winner' listing on Ink Tip * Invitation to the Awards Ceremony in Hollywood on July 26 Prizes for the 20 finalists include: * Guaranteed circulation to over 20 Companies * Five-year memberships to Script Pimp's Writers Database * Featured 'Script Pimp Finalist' listing on Ink Tip

Filmaka's aim is to encourage and inspire filmmakers from all around the globe with its upcoming May competition. Its new theme is "The Game." Film entries must run between 1-3 minutes in length and can be in any language (English subtitles are encouraged). Each month the top 15-20 Filmaka's win cash prizes and the chance show their filmmaking talent to its award-winning jury. Jurors include Colin Firth, Werner Herzog, Neil LaBute, John Madden, Paul Shrader and Wim Wenders. The jury picks three winners every month. There are more prizes and all three are allowed to compete in our 'Filmaka of the Year' contest at the end of 2007, where one director wins a feature film deal. Entry is free to all students. AAA Screenplay Contest gives away over $8,000 in cash and access to more than 350 companies, plus two TV prizes (one for sitcoms, the other for one-hour dramatic) this year, and four CS Genre Fellowships have been created to find promising writers and offer them the guidance of a CREATIVE SCREENWRITING mentor to help them take their work to the next level. These special fellowships will be awarded in the Drama, Sci-Fi/Fantasy, Thriller/Horror and Comedy genres.

Entry fee is $40 for features, $30 for teleplays. Quarterfinalists will be notified and posted on the website by Sept. 15. Semifinalists will be notified and posted on the website by Oct. 1. Finalists will be announced by Oct. 15, and the winner will be chosen no later than Nov. 1.
